In his brief reign of two many years, he reunited the Arabian Peninsula and commenced conquests in Syria and Iraq, which were afterwards carried on productively by his successors until 656 CE when the primary Islamic civil war, the main Fitna (656-661 CE) erupted and growth was quickly halted. It was also for the duration of Abu Bakr's reign that the revelations dictated by Muhammad have been compiled in the form with the Islamic holy scripture: the Quran.

Abu Bakr accompanied Usama a long way out of Medina. The youthful commander was riding a horse, although the Caliph walked by his facet. Usama reported, "O successor from the holy Prophet, In addition, you get over a horse and allow Gentlemen to receive down." "By Allah," replied Abu Bakr, "I'll agree to neither of the two items. What damage is There exists there if slightly dust falls on my toes, while I go some measures in the best way of Allah? For each and every The first step requires in Allah's way, one particular receives the reward of seven hundred excellent deeds." Omar was also on the list of Males below Usama's command. But Abu Bakr necessary him, at Medina, for purposed of advice. So he built a request to Usama, to allow Omar to stay in Medina. The request was granted. Ahead of the Caliph bade farewell to Usama, he gave him Substantially practical information. Many of it had been: "Appear! Be not dishonest. Will not deceive everyone. Tend not to hide the booty you get. Don't mutilate anyone. Do not eliminate the aged, the kids and also the women. Do not established hearth to date-palms. Never Minimize down fruit trees. Don't slaughter a goat, or simply a cow, or maybe a camel, except for applications of foodstuff. You are going to come upon people who have give up the earth and they are sitting in monasteries. Leave them by yourself." Usama's expedition proved extremely thriving. He raided the frontier districts of Syria and was back in Medina just after forty times. The expedition experienced One more M Abubakar good end result. It proved a watch-opener to people who thought Islam was dying out. That they had a transparent proof that Islam was nonetheless in a position to obstacle among the best powers of the globe. This overawed the wavering tribes. A few of the tribes which experienced left Islam actually, rentered its fold.
